| /* Include all the header files of alloc here, to make sure they're not
 | |
|    processed when including alloc.c below, such that the redefinitions of malloc
 | |
|    and realloc are only effective in alloc.c itself.  This does not work for
 | |
|    config.h, because it's not wrapped in "#ifndef CONFIG_H\n#define CONFIG_H"
 | |
|    and "#endif" but that does not seem to be harmful.  */
 | |
| 
 | |
| #include "config.h"
 | |
| 
 | |
| #include <errno.h>
 | |
| #include <stdlib.h>
 | |
| #include <sys/types.h>
 | |
| #include <inttypes.h>
 | |
| 
 | |
| #include "backtrace.h"
 | |
| #include "internal.h"
 | |
| 
 | |
| extern void *instrumented_malloc (size_t size);
 | |
| extern void *instrumented_realloc (void *ptr, size_t size);
 | |
| 
 | |
| #define malloc instrumented_malloc
 | |
| #define realloc instrumented_realloc
 | |
| #include "alloc.c"
 | |
| #undef malloc
 | |
| #undef realloc
 | |
| 
 | |
| static uint64_t nr_allocs = 0;
 | |
| static uint64_t fail_at_alloc = 0;
 | |
| 
 | |
| extern int at_fail_alloc_p (void);
 | |
| extern uint64_t get_nr_allocs (void);
 | |
| extern void set_fail_at_alloc (uint64_t);
 | |
| 
 | |
| void *
 | |
| instrumented_malloc (size_t size)
 | |
| {
 | |
|   void *res;
 | |
| 
 | |
|   if (at_fail_alloc_p ())
 | |
|     return NULL;
 | |
| 
 | |
|   res = malloc (size);
 | |
|   if (res != NULL)
 | |
|     nr_allocs++;
 | |
| 
 | |
|   return res;
 | |
| }
 | |
| 
 | |
| void *
 | |
| instrumented_realloc (void *ptr, size_t size)
 | |
| {
 | |
|   void *res;
 | |
| 
 | |
|   if (size != 0)
 | |
|     {
 | |
|       if (at_fail_alloc_p ())
 | |
| 	return NULL;
 | |
|     }
 | |
| 
 | |
|   res = realloc (ptr, size);
 | |
|   if (res != NULL)
 | |
|     nr_allocs++;
 | |
| 
 | |
|   return res;
 | |
| }
 | |
| 
 | |
| int
 | |
| at_fail_alloc_p (void)
 | |
| {
 | |
|   return fail_at_alloc == nr_allocs + 1;
 | |
| }
 | |
| 
 | |
| uint64_t
 | |
| get_nr_allocs (void)
 | |
| {
 | |
|   return nr_allocs;
 | |
| }
 | |
| 
 | |
| void
 | |
| set_fail_at_alloc (uint64_t nr)
 | |
| {
 | |
|   fail_at_alloc = nr;
 | |
| }
